Mahinda banned from leaving the country

Colombo. Gotabaya Rajapaksa has finally resigned as the President of Sri Lanka. He told the Speaker of the Parliament of Sri Lanka, Mahinda Yapa Abhayawardene that Gotabaya has sent his resignation from Singapore. After his resignation, former Prime Minister Ranil Wickremesinghe was sworn in as the interim President. He became the President of Sri Lanka for seven days. The country will elect a new President on July 20. It is being told that Ranil Wickremesinghe will be the presidential candidate from the ruling party ie the party of Rajapaksa family.

However, Sri Lanka’s Chief Justice Jayanta Jayasuriya administered the oath of office to Ranil Wickremesinghe on Friday. Earlier, Speaker Abhaywardene told that the Parliament will meet on Saturday. He appealed to the public to maintain a peaceful environment for the MPs so that they can participate in the process of presidential election.

On the other hand, the court swung into action after Gotabaya Rajapaksa fled the country while in office. The country’s Supreme Court has issued an order saying that former Prime Minister Mahinda Rajapaksa and former Finance Minister Basil Rajapaksa cannot leave the country. It is worth mentioning that Basil Rajapaksa had tried to run out of the country from the airport like Mahinda Rajapaksa but he did not succeed. Mahinda Rajapaksa resigned after the Sri Lankan nationals started protesting and since then there is no information about him.

Significantly, the citizens of Sri Lanka have been protesting for three months. After the terrible economic crisis started in the country, people took to the streets and started a movement to oust the Rajapaksa family from power. At present the situation in Sri Lanka is very bad. Along with food and drink, there is a huge shortage of all things like petrol, diesel, electricity, medicine in the country. Only after the new President and the new government comes, there will be a concrete initiative to improve the situation.
